According to a survey conducted in the US, a full 71% of responses indicated that they believe the economic system is skewed in favor of certain groups. In response to which came closer to their opinion on the US economy, three choices were presented:
The economic system is rigged in favor of certain groups The economy system is fair to all Americans Don’t know The overwhelming majority picked the first option. This held true across demographics, showing no difference in responses from different races or political affiliation.
Stagnant economy since the 1990s, another recession soon
According to US Census data adjusted for inflation, the median household income has remained stagnant over the last 20 years. This means that the average American middle-class family makes about the same as they would have in the 1990s. Meanwhile, the cost of living has skyrocketed since then. What $20 could have bought in 1994 would now take $32, meaning the US middle class is worse off today than 20 years ago.
